2023–2025 Joint Japan–World Bank Graduate Scholarship Program (Fully-funded)

The Joint Japan/World Bank Graduate Scholarship Program 2023–2025 is now accepting applications. The Joint Japan/World Bank Graduate Scholarship Program (JJ/WBGSP) helps people from certain developing countries get master’s degrees in fields related to development if they have relevant professional experience and have helped their countries develop in the past.

Depending on how much money is available, JJWBGSP gives scholarships to 45 Master’s programs at 27 universities in the United States, Europe, Africa, Oceania, and Japan. These programs are in important development fields like infrastructure management, economic policy management, and tax policy.

Scholarship Coverage

The JJ/WBGSP scholarship offers the following advantages to the recipient:

  • Airfare in economy class between your home nation and the host university at the beginning of your study program and soon after the scholarship period is over
  • Scholars will also be given a US$500 travel allowance for each trip in addition to the two-way flight transportation;
  • Tuition for your graduate program and the price of your university-provided basic health insurance.
  • During the scholarship period, a monthly stipend is given to cover all living costs, such as housing, food, and books, while the student is in school. Depending on the host nation, the allowance varies in size.

Eligibility

Candidate must;

  • Be a citizen of one of the developing nations on this list that is a World Bank member;
  • Not possess dual citizenship with any advanced nation;
  • Remain healthy;
  • Possess a Bachelor’s (or comparable) degree that was acquired at least three years before the application deadline;
  • Possess a Bachelor’s (or equivalent) degree and three years or more of recent job experience in the development sector;
  • Be working full-time and getting paid to do work related to development at the time you send in your scholarship application.
  • Have a bachelor’s degree or an equivalent degree from a university that you got no more than 3 years ago and no more than 6 years before the application deadline.
  • Be admitted unconditionally (except for funding) for the following academic year to at least one of the JJ/WBGSP participating master’s programs that are situated outside of the applicant’s country of citizenship and country of residence listed at the time of the call for scholarship applications opens on or before the scholarship application deadline date.
  • Before submitting your application, you must upload your letter of admission.

Choice Process

The JJ/WBGSP uses the following process to evaluate scholarship applications from people living in poor countries. The goal is to choose the applicants who are most likely to make a difference in the development of their countries after they finish their graduate studies.

Each eligible application is looked at by two qualified assessors, who do it separately. They then give each application a score between 1 and 10 based on four key factors and how much they depend on each other:

  • Professional Experience Quality (30% weight)
  • Professional Recommendation Quality (Weight: 30%)
  • Quality of Your Home Country Commitment (30% weight)
  • Background education level quality (10% weight)

The JJ/WBGSP Secretariat picks the finalists based on the average score of the two assessors and the following criteria:

  • Keeping the regional distribution of awards fairly diverse
  • Preserving a fair distribution of rewards by gender
  • When evaluating the employment experience and other parts of an application, unusual circumstances or hardships
  • Awards of scholarships to applicants who, other things being equal, have little recourse to funding for graduate study abroad
